Introduction to Temari

Temari, one of the prominent characters in Naruto, is the eldest child of the Fourth Kazekage, Rasa, and is a member of the Sand Village’s elite ninja team. She is part of the Sand Siblings, along with her two younger brothers, Gaara and Kankuro. Temari stands out not just for her strong leadership qualities and battle prowess, but also for her distinct personality, which sets her apart from other characters in the series. Her character design, which includes her large fan, has made her an easily recognizable figure in the Naruto universe.

Temari’s Age in the Original Naruto Series

The original Naruto series, which began in 2002, introduces Temari as one of the major characters from the Hidden Sand Village. At the time of her first appearance, Temari is a young adult ninja who is part of the Sand’s invasion force. She is about 15 years old when she first meets Naruto and the other characters from Konoha (the Hidden Leaf Village). This is during the Chunin Exams and the subsequent invasion of Konoha, which is one of the defining arcs of the series.

In the Naruto series, Temari is presented as a highly skilled and formidable ninja. She wields a large folding fan, which she uses to create powerful gusts of wind, a unique fighting style that distinguishes her from other characters. Her skill in battle, particularly during her fight with Tenten in the Chunin Exams, reveals her tactical mind and resourcefulness. Temari’s age during this period is confirmed to be 15, placing her in the upper range of the standard Chunin Exam participants.

Temari’s Age in Naruto Shippuden

Naruto Shippuden, which picks up the storyline after a two-and-a-half-year time skip, introduces a more mature Temari. At the start of Shippuden, Temari is around 19 years old, making her one of the older characters in the series at this point. She has grown both in strength and wisdom, taking on a leadership role in the Sand Village as well as becoming an instrumental part of the team working with Konoha.

Temari plays a key role in Naruto Shippuden, especially in the battles during the Fourth Great Ninja War. Her growth as a character is evident in how she handles combat situations and how she interacts with the other characters. She is no longer just a warrior from the Sand Village; she has become an experienced strategist with a deep understanding of battle tactics. Temari’s Age in Boruto: Naruto Next Generations

By the time Boruto: Naruto Next Generations is set, Temari has matured into adulthood and has taken on the responsibilities of being a wife and a mother. In Boruto, which is set years after the events of Naruto Shippuden, Temari is in her early 30s, around 31 or 32 years old. Her role in Boruto showcases her continued importance in the Ninja World, not just as a skilled ninja, but also as a mother to her children, one of whom is Shikadai, the son she shares with her husband, Shikamaru Nara.

In Boruto, Temari’s character remains strong, wise, and compassionate. Despite her more mature role, her battle techniques, including her use of the large fan, are still a key element of her character design. As a mother and a supporting character to the next generation, Temari’s age in Boruto reflects her transition into adulthood while maintaining the leadership and fierce determination she is known for.
